    What angle is the solar photovoltaic panel

    For most homeowners, the ideal angle for a solar panel installation is close to or equal to the latitude of your home. This angle is typically between 30 degrees and 45 degrees.


    FAQs about What angle is the solar photovoltaic panel

    What is the best angle for solar panels in the UK?

    The best all-year-round angle for PV (photovoltaic) solar panels in the UK is 35-40 degrees. The best angle for each region within the UK will vary slightly within this. For seasonal changes, the best angle for summertime is 20 degrees and 50 degrees in winter. See below for the optimum angle for each UK region.

    What angle should a photovoltaic panel face?

    In the northern hemisphere, the sun is due south at solar noon. Therefore, to get the very best out of your photovoltaic panels, you would typically face them due south at the optimum angle so that the panel is receiving as much sunlight as possible at this time.

    What is the optimal tilt angle of photovoltaic solar panels?

    The optimal tilt angle of photovoltaic solar panels is that the surface of the solar panel faces the Sun perpendicularly. However, the angle of incidence of solar radiation varies during the day and during different times of the year.

    How to use solar photovoltaic electricity at night

    Since you can't rely on energy from your solar array at night you have two main options; store and use excess energy generated in the daytime or get your power from the utility grid.


    FAQs about How to use solar photovoltaic electricity at night

    Can you use solar energy at night?

    However, what you can do is store the energy you generate during the day on a battery pack so that you still have power even when there's little to no sunlight. Whilst solar panels are not effective at generating energy at night, new technology means it's easier than ever to store and use solar energy at night that was produced during the day.

    How do solar panels cool at night?

    Their innovation takes advantage of the fact that solar panels cool at night. Power can be generated from the temperature difference between the cooling panels and the still-warm surrounding air. This is done using a thermoelectric generator, which produces power as heat passes through it.

    Are solar panels bad for your health?

    An extremely small and weak electromagnetic field is created whenever electricity is produced by solar panels and transmitted to the power grid. While this may sound ominous, the World Health Organization reports that exposure to low-level electromagnetic fields has been studied extensively, with no evidence of any conclusive harm to human health.

    Are photovoltaic panels safe?

    One of the frequently asked questions about the impact of photovoltaic panels on health is that of potential electrocution. While it is true that the voltage in a working system may reach about 600–800 V, the system has appropriate lightning protection, short circuit protection and overload protection, which eliminate the risk of electrocution.
